> Port length
>
> I am using the same port as per your parts list. What length do you recommend and how does the length affect the sound?
I use the stock 4" in most cases. you can test lengthening the port by rolling up a 5" strip of stiff paper and sticking in in the port. Slide the paper in and out until you get the best sound for your room.

> Veneer and cabinet round over
>
> I only have a 1/4" router and can therefore only get 1/2" round over bits...not 3/4"
>
> Do you happen to know if veneer splits using a smaller bit?
I hate to disparage your equipment, but a 1/4" router is not much more than a toy. The only 1/4" bits I use are a straight bit for cutting holes and a 1/4" round-over for internal braces. You will probably be able to get 10-mil paper backed veneer over a 1/2" round-over if you are very careful. Wet the veneer before you start around a corner and let it soak for a few minutes. I would run a test of this with your chosen veneer before I start rounding the corners. You might consider renting a decent 1/2" at least 2hp router for this job.
